The GLAAD Media Awards — which recognize and honor media for their fair, accurate and inclusive representations of the lesbian, gay, bisexual, and transgender community and the issues that affect their lives — held its Los Angeles ceremony on April 10 at the Westin Bonaventure.
Among the award winners was Kristin Chenoweth, who received the Vanguard Award, given to media professionals who have increased the visibility and understanding of the LGBT community. The honor was presented to her by Sean Hayes, who was her Broadway co-star in Promises, Promises.
There was a tie for Outstanding Comedy Series with winners including Fox’s Glee and ABC’s Modern Family, with additional awards going to I Love You Phillip Morris, Project Runway, MSNBC’s The Last Word with Lawrence O’Donnell, and NBC Entertainment Chairman Robert Greenblatt.
Among the additional celebrities who attended the ceremony and/or presented awards were stage veterans Melissa Etheridge, Megan Hilty, Jai Rodriguez, and Allison Janney, as well as Grey’s Anatomy star Sarah Drew, award-winning film actress Kirsten Dunst, Academy Award winner Marlee Matlin, and rock star Meat Loaf.
